The Game of Napoleon

The game of Napoleon can be played by 3 to 7 players, and it revolves around bidding, tactics, and clever maneuvers. The deck is shuffled, and each player receives an equal number of cards. Depending on the number of participants, the game requires a specific number of cards, generally leaving a set aside as the "kitty." The main objective is to win the most tricks and thus become the "Napoleon," the lead player for that round.
